def _test_idist_methods_in_hvd_context(backend, device):
    # We explicitly set _model as _SerialModel
    # then call idist.* methods and check that they give correct values
    import horovod.torch as hvd

    from ignite.distributed.utils import _SerialModel, _set_model

    hvd.init()

    _set_model(_SerialModel())

    ws = hvd.size()
    rank = hvd.rank()
    local_rank = hvd.local_rank()

    if torch.cuda.is_available():
        torch.cuda.set_device(local_rank)

    _test_distrib_config(local_rank,
                         backend=backend,
                         ws=ws,
                         true_device=device,
                         rank=rank)

    hvd.shutdown()

def _test_idist_methods_in_native_context_set_local_rank(backend, device, local_rank):
    # We explicitly set _model as _SerialModel
    # then call idist.* methods and check that they give correct values
    from ignite.distributed.utils import _SerialModel, _set_model

    _set_model(_SerialModel())

    lrank = int(os.environ["LOCAL_RANK"])
    del os.environ["LOCAL_RANK"]

    ws = dist.get_world_size()
    rank = dist.get_rank()

    idist.set_local_rank(local_rank)

    _test_distrib_config(local_rank=local_rank, backend=backend, ws=ws, true_device=device, rank=rank)

    os.environ["LOCAL_RANK"] = str(lrank)
